  • 1 Chicken breast
    cut into strips
  • A handful of fresh white breadcrumbs
  • 1 Egg
    beaten
  • 1 Small potato

  • molecules.methodlist.counterprefix 1

    Prick the potato with a fork and par-cook in the microwave for 5 minutes. Cut into small wedges.

  • molecules.methodlist.counterprefix 2

    Place the potato wedges on a greased baking sheet and drizzle with a little olive oil.

  • molecules.methodlist.counterprefix 3

    Dip the chicken strips in egg and then breadcrumbs and place on the greased baking sheet.

  • molecules.methodlist.counterprefix 4

    Cook the chicken and potatoes in 220°C for 20 minutes or until cooked through.

  • molecules.methodlist.counterprefix 5

    Serve as a finger food.

  • molecules.methodlist.counterprefix 6

    Why not try turkey instead of chicken?
